Output 8c7c94b2d2060ec0fd8692807b30cfee90d622b6108244eed48163d43da44004:2

value
675865860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68e9cbe130e80c378b1c783bb5b2617d11f1730b OP_EQUALVERIFY OP_CHECKSIG
address
1AZjMQk64f8HLjB5MetoKuRSA7TQ6s64qV
transaction
8c7c94b2d2060ec0fd8692807b30cfee90d622b6108244eed48163d43da44004
spent
true